    Bought my '05 on July 13th, 2008... my 20th birthday. Bought at higher 11's, but 14,2XX out the door after taxes. Had 34k miles on it.

    Mechanically... rebuilt transmission... twice. Some reason a transmission shop doesn't seem to know how to build a 4T65E properly. Recently as in less than 20k miles... new struts, strut mount, all new hubs all around, all new cv shafts, new ball joints, and all new rotors+brake pads+rear calipers.

    Now with 120k miles on it, Id be glad if I'd see 6k for it. But in reality maybe 5k.... maybe. But the car is going no where... but if someone offered me $10 grand then bye bye car.
